Output 9353743868f8d226a2973d3edf84e08d14ef7dadfe40bace5e83ab3444ac23d1:41

value
33698364
script pubkey
OP_0 OP_PUSHBYTES_20 6c7d029b392fe0c13d3b18636e5a2e69073d9431
address
ltc1qd37s9xee9lsvz0fmrp3kuk3wdyrnm9p3hja02f
transaction
9353743868f8d226a2973d3edf84e08d14ef7dadfe40bace5e83ab3444ac23d1
spent
true